The Oracle Cloud Infrastructure (OCI) team builds and manages a suite of massive scale, integrated cloud services in a broadly distributed, multi-tenant cloud environment. OCI is committed to providing the best in cloud products that meet the needs of our customers who are tackling some of the world’s biggest challenges.

This is an opportunity to become a part of Observability, a core OCI team that has an impact on external and internal customers along with all other OCI cloud services!

Observability org of OCI is on a continued mission of delivering a world-class Integrated Observability and Management platform for our customers, that can work seamlessly across OCI, other clouds, and on-premises to provide a uniform view. Our integrated Observability and Management platform combines Logging, Monitoring, Auditing, SIEM, Events, and other services. We will continue to innovate on each of these services to make them feature-rich world-class services on their own and integrate them seamlessly to provide meaningful insights into your resources and data!

Who are we looking for?

We are looking for engineers with distributed systems expertise. You should have experience with the design of major features and launching them into production. You’ve operated high-scale services and understand how to make them more resilient. You will own projects and work on tasks independently while guiding other engineers in the team. The ideal candidate will own the software design and development for major components of Oracle’s Cloud Infrastructure. You should be both a rock-solid coder and a distributed systems generalist, able to dive deep into any part of the stack and low-level systems, as well as design broad distributed system interactions. You should value simplicity and scale, work comfortably in a collaborative, agile environment, and be excited to learn. Leading contributor individually and as a team member, providing direction and mentoring to others.

Required Qualifications

BS or MS degree in Computer Science or relevant technical field involving coding or equivalent practical experience

4-8 years of total experience in software development

Demonstrated ability to write great code using Java, C#, C or similar OO languages

Proven ability to deliver products and experience with the full software development lifecycle

Experience working on large-scale, highly distributed services infrastructure

Experience working in an operational environment with mission-critical tier-one live site servicing

Systematic problem-solving approach, strong communication skills, a sense of ownership, and drive

Experience designing architectures that demonstrate deep technical depth in one area, or span many products, to enable high availability, scalability, market-leading features and fl exibility to meet future business demands

Preferred Qualifications

Experience with Kafka, Apache Spark, Lucene, Kubernetes and other big data technologies

Hands-on experience developing and maintaining services on a public cloud platform (e.g., AWS, Azure,Oracle)

Knowledge of Infrastructure as Code (IAC) languages, preferably Terraform

Strong knowledge of databases (SQL and NoSQL)

Oracle US offers a comprehensive benefits package which includes the following:

  • Medical, dental, and vision insurance, including expert medical opinion
  • Short term disability and long term disability
  • Life insurance and AD&D
  • Supplemental life insurance (Employee/Spouse/Child)
  • Health care and dependent care Flexible Spending Accounts
  • Pre-tax commuter and parking benefits
  • 401(k) Savings and Investment Plan with company match
  • Paid time off: Flexible Vacation is provided to all eligible employees assigned to a salaried (non-overtime eligible) position. Accrued Vacation is provided to all other employees eligible for vacation benefits. For employees working at least 35 hours per week, the vacation accrual rate is 13 days annually for the first three years of employment and 18 days annually for subsequent years of employment. Vacation accrual is prorated for employees working between 20 and 34 hours per week. Employees working fewer than 20 hours per week are not eligible for vacation.
  • 11 paid holidays
  • Paid sick leave: 72 hours of paid sick leave upon date of hire. Refreshes each calendar year. Unused balance will carry over each year up to a maximum cap of 112 hours.
  • Paid parental leave
  • Adoption assistance
  • Employee Stock Purchase Plan
  • Financial planning and group legal
  • Voluntary benefits including auto, homeowner and pet insurance
